公会系统源码解析与优化策略探讨

公会系统源码解析与优化策略探讨

晓亦 2024-11-16 海外留学 479 次浏览 0个评论
摘要:本文解析了公会系统的源码,并对其进行了优化。通过对公会系统源码的深入研究,我们深入了解了系统的内部结构和运行机制。在此基础上,我们针对系统的瓶颈和性能问题进行了优化,提高了系统的运行效率和稳定性。这些优化措施包括改进算法、优化数据结构、提高系统响应速度等。我们的工作有助于提升公会系统的性能和用户体验,为未来的系统升级和维护提供了重要的参考依据。

随着网络游戏的普及,公会系统已成为游戏中不可或缺的一部分,它为玩家提供了一个交流互动的平台,并增强了游戏的社交性和团队协作性,本文将深入探讨公会系统的源码实现,解析其核心功能,并针对性能优化提供建议,公会系统一般包括用户注册、公会创建、公会管理、公会活动、公会排名和公会聊天等功能模块。

源码核心功能解析

1、用户注册与登录模块:采用成熟的框架如Spring Security实现,保障用户信息的安全存储和验证。

2、公会创建与管理模块:允许玩家创建公会、设定名称、徽章等;管理包括成员增删、职务设置、资金管理等。

3、公会活动与挑战模块:包括公会战、公会任务等,是提升公会排名和影响力的主要途径。

4、公会排名与展示模块:根据活跃度、实力等进行排名,采用相应的数据结构和算法实现。

5、公会聊天功能:实现玩家间的实时交流,为玩家提供便捷的沟通渠道。

源码优化建议

1、数据库优化:

- 索引优化:对频繁查询的字段建立索引。

公会系统源码解析与优化策略探讨

- 数据库分区:采用分区技术提高数据检索速度。

- 缓存优化:使用Redis等缓存技术减少数据库压力。

2、代码优化:

- 代码重构:提高代码的可维护性和可读性。

- 异步处理:采用异步处理耗时任务。

- 并发处理:采用多线程、分布式等技术提高并发处理能力。

公会系统源码解析与优化策略探讨

- 负载均衡:采用负载均衡技术应对大量玩家同时操作。

3、安全性优化:加强系统安全防护,防止SQL注入、跨站脚本等攻击;对敏感数据进行加密存储和传输;对玩家的操作进行日志记录等。

除了上述优化建议,还需要考虑以下几点:

数据实时性与准确性保障

通过定期同步数据、优化数据库结构、采用消息队列等技术来保证数据的实时性和准确性。

常见问题解答

1、如何防止恶意攻击?

答:加强系统安全防护,使用成熟的安全框架和组件,对敏感数据进行加密存储和传输,对玩家的操作进行日志记录等。

公会系统源码解析与优化策略探讨

2、如何平衡服务器负载?

答:采用负载均衡技术,定期监控服务器运行状况,及时扩展或缩减服务器规模。

3、如何优化用户体验?

答:从界面设计、交互流程、功能设计等方面入手,提供简洁明了的界面和丰富的功能;加强系统的稳定性和可靠性;保障游戏的实时性,减少延迟和卡顿现象等,同时建立完善的错误处理和提示机制,对玩家的错误操作进行友好的提示和引导,此外还需要建立完善的备份和恢复机制以及错误处理和提示机制来保障数据的完整性和可用性并提升用户体验,这些措施共同提高了系统的可靠性和可用性为游戏玩家提供更好的体验和服务,总之公会系统源码的实现和优化是一个不断学习和实践的过程需要不断提高技能和能力以适应不断变化的市场需求和技术发展。

公会系统的源码实现与优化是一个复杂而有趣的过程,需要开发者不断学习和实践,以提高自身的技能和能力,为游戏玩家提供更好的体验和服务,也需要关注游戏的实际需求和市场变化,不断改进和优化系统功能,以满足玩家的需求和期望。

转载请注明来自北京伯乐育星国际教育咨询有限公司,本文标题:《公会系统源码解析与优化策略探讨》

百度分享代码,如果开启HTTPS请参考李洋个人博客
每一天,每一秒,你所做的决定都会改变你的人生!
Top